1)Vortex Viper PST Gen II 5-25x50mm FFP Rifle Scope

The Vortex Optics Viper PST Gen II 5-25x50mm First Focal Plane Riflescope is widely regarded as one of the Best Vortex Scopes for 300 Win Mag Rifle due to its blend of precision, durability, and long range flexibility. It is designed for shooters who need reliable performance from mid range engagements out to extended distances. The 5 to 25x magnification range paired with a 50mm objective lens allows it to adapt easily to different shooting situations, making it suitable for hunting and precision shooting alike.
This scope uses a first focal plane reticle system, which keeps the reticle accurate at every magnification level. That means holdovers and wind references remain consistent whether zoomed in or out, improving confidence during real shooting conditions. The turret system is built for precise dialing, with laser etched markings that are easy to read in the field. A zero stop mechanism helps shooters return quickly to their original sight setting after adjustments, while a fiber optic rotation indicator provides clear feedback on turret position.
Optical performance is strengthened through extra low dispersion glass, which enhances clarity, sharpness, and color accuracy. Fully multi coated lenses improve light transmission, helping maintain a bright and usable image in low light environments such as dawn or dusk. Protective coatings on the lens surfaces also help resist scratches, oil, and debris, supporting long term reliability in rugged conditions.
The reticle design offers detailed hold points for elevation and wind correction while keeping the view clean and easy to follow. Illumination settings include multiple brightness levels with off positions between each step, allowing smoother adjustment depending on lighting conditions in the field.
Durability is a key strength of this riflescope. It is constructed from a single piece of aircraft grade aluminum, giving it a solid structure that can withstand heavy recoil from powerful rifles like the 300 Win Mag. The scope is also O ring sealed and argon purged, ensuring waterproof and fogproof performance even in challenging weather conditions.

Factors to Consider When Choosing the Best Vortex Scopes for 300 Win Mag Rifle
Magnification range
A flexible magnification range allows shooters to adapt to both close and long distance targets. Lower settings help with wider field of view, while higher settings improve precision at distance.
Objective lens size
A larger objective lens allows more light to enter the scope, improving brightness and clarity. This is especially useful in low light environments, although it can increase weight and size.
Reticle design
Reticle style affects how easily a shooter can estimate range and apply corrections. First focal plane reticles provide consistent scaling, which is helpful for long range accuracy and holdover use.
Turret system quality
Reliable turrets allow accurate and repeatable adjustments for wind and elevation. Clear markings and smooth operation improve confidence when dialing for distance shooting.
Optical performance
High quality glass and coatings improve image sharpness, contrast, and color accuracy. Better optics also reduce distortion and enhance visibility in low light conditions.
Build strength and durability
A strong scope body ensures it can handle recoil and rough field conditions. Sealing against moisture and fog also improves performance in unpredictable weather.
Parallax adjustment
Parallax control helps align the reticle with the target at different distances. This reduces aiming error and improves precision during long range shooting.
Weight and balance
Scope weight affects rifle handling and comfort during extended use. A balanced setup improves stability and makes the rifle easier to carry in the field.
